David Johnson, I think. Would really love to trade out of that pick though. If you don't want to go RB, I have no problem with Amari Cooper either. I would also have Howard or Ajayi nowhere near my top ten in a Superflex dynasty.

I play a good amount of Superflex, and it's very intriguing because people don't know how to evaluate the QBs. Everyone does it differently. Even the "experts" on sites have some pretty terrible Superflex or 2QB rankings, though even saying that it's just my subjective opinion saying they are terrible.

That said, I would draft QBs extremely high. The teams that have two good starting QB's are consistently the top ones in Superflex leagues. The group that I would target is Winston, Mariota, and Carr and try to pick one or both the 2nd and 3rd round.

If you do get DJ, you could also just become a win-now team. Draft Brady & Brees in the first 5 rounds and you will be in the championship mix immediately with those three. Just depends what you are trying to do.
